ONE LOVED COT I KNOW
TRENCH THOUGHTS
CHRISTMAS 1916
Not of the Christ who came
Two thousand years ago;
Only the firelight glow
In one loved cot I know.

Not of those shepherds old,
Watching their flocks by night!
But Father, and Kate with a light,
Seeing that cows is right.
